行数
• 块以及空块的数量
• 平均的可用空闲空间
• 链接行或移植行的数量
• 行的平均长度
• 最后一次 ANALYZE 的日期和样本大小
• 数据字典视图:DBA_TABLES
示例在以下示例中可以看到大约有五个空块必须监视空块占所有块的比
例
SQL> analyze table employees estimate statistics for table;
SQL> select num_rows,blocks,empty_blocks
2 , avg_space,avg_row_len, sample_size
3 from dba_tables
4 where table_name = 'EMPLOYEES' and owner = user;
NUM_ROWS BLOCKS EMPTY_BLOCKS AVG_SPACE AVG_ROW_LEN SAMPLE_SIZE
-------- ------ ------------ --------- ----------- -----------
15132 434 5 225 48 1064
当确定存在空块的问题时应重新编排表可以使用各种不同的技术例如
导出和导入SQL*Loader 和 SQL*Plus 重新编排该表从而提高表访问的
效率
oracle表统计
最新推荐文章于 2025-11-13 14:21:00 发布
博客介绍了Oracle表的统计信息,包括行数、块及空块数量等。给出示例展示如何查看表统计信息,如使用ANALYZE和SELECT语句。当确定存在空块问题时,可采用导出和导入、SQL*Loader和SQL*Plus等技术重新编排表,以提高表访问效率。

1658

被折叠的 条评论
为什么被折叠?



